The Collected Letters of Robert E. Howard Volume Two: 1930-1932

Robert E. Howard

First published 2007
Series Robert E. Howard LettersThe Collected Letters of Robert E. Howard (First Edition)
Publisher The Robert E. Howard Foundation Press
Format Hardcover
Type Nonfiction
Cover art Jim Keegan & Ruth Keegan
Pages xviii+525
Price $59.00


Edited by Rob Roehm.
Annotations by Rusty Burke.
Limited to 300 numbered copies.
A copy of the postcard on p. 301 laid in. p113, "Surprized" is Howard's spelling.
